DISCUSSION:

The Humboldt County Civil Grand Jury investigates and reports on the operations, accounts and records of the officers, departments or functions of the County of Humboldt and other local government agencies. The county thanks the Grand Jury for its hard work and efforts its members have put forth in their 2023-24 Grand Jury reports.

 

To date, the Humboldt County Civil Grand Jury has submitted eight reports to the Presiding Judge of the Superior Court, of which six pertained to and were received by the County of Humboldt. Your Board provided responses to one report on July 23, 2024 and two reports on Aug. 13, 2024. Three remaining reports that require responses from your Board are before you today, and they are as follows:

 

                     “Humboldt County Hiring: Status, Process, and the Future” (Attachment 1)

                     “Humboldt County, Behavioral Health, Substance Use, and the Streets What Works” (Attachment 3)

                     “Humboldt County Child Welfare Services Office of the Ombudsperson” (Attachment 5)
